Outsourcing American Jobs

Did you know that the U.S. tax code rewards companies for outsourcing American jobs overseas? Well it does. It does it by allowing the cost of moving the jobs overseas to be deducted as a business expense.

If you think this sounds idiotic then you agree with senate Democrats and four senate Republicans, Scott P. Brown of Massachusetts, Susan Collins and Olympia J. Snowe of Maine, and Dean Heller of Nevada, that the senate should vote on bill S. 3364, sponsored by Senator Debbie Stabenow, D-Mich., which would end that tax break while continuing to allow a deduction for jobs returned to this country or moved within the United States.

Unfortunately, Senate Republicans have filibustered that bill and an attempt at closure, which requires 60 votes, failed 56-42 with every single Republican senator, other than the four noted above, voting against cloture.
